Abstract

本发明提供了一种WPC木塑六层共挤一步法复合地板生产线,包括挤出机、模具、五辊成型机、冷却托架、两辊压花成型机、托架、牵引机、剪板机、输送托架和自动抬板机;所述模具安装于挤出机上,其与五辊成型机配合,将挤出的物料直接送入五辊成型机;所述冷却托架设置于五辊成型机的出口处,其与五辊成型机配合,将五辊成型机压制成型的地板进行冷却;冷却托架后部设置有两辊压花成型机;两辊压花成型机通过托架与牵引机连接;所述牵引机与剪板机和输送托架连接;所述输送托架尾端设置有自动抬板机。

背景技术
木塑地板是一种木料和塑料粉碎混合热成型的新型地板,该类型的地板兼具木材和塑料的优点,在具备木材特性和手感的同时,还具备塑料材料韧性好强度好和容易加工的优点。其采用的木材为废弃木料和农林作物的废旧纤维,材料中不存在有害成分,尤其是现有木质地板常见的甲醛和苯类有机挥发性污染物,且还可回收循环引用,是一种环保、绿色、节能的新型地板制品。现有技术中的木塑地板生产线存在着生产效率低、地板层之间粘合度差等诸多缺点,仍需要进一步的改进。

在生产过程中,挤出机挤出的材料通过模具进入五辊成型机,首先从成型机的第一辊和第二辊进入后,随着辊筒旋转后进入第三辊,然后把彩膜层和耐磨层分别经过各自的展平辊后进入耐高温的硅胶辊,硅胶辊采用可调节式汽缸控制;上硅胶辊是压耐磨层的,下硅胶辊是压彩膜的;彩膜和耐磨层经过胶辊压住后与共挤层形成了一体,然后再由第五支辊和第四支辊挤压,即为产品成型的尺寸,第五和第四支辊筒都是哑光辊,主要作用除了压成型还起到消光的作用;再压彩膜和耐磨层的同时,在共挤层的背面覆上一层防滑层;产品从五辊成型机出来后进入冷却托架冷却,进入压花装置,进行压花处理,压花结束后经过牵引机牵出,经过拱形托架后有编码器控制长度,精密剪板机裁断后接料台输送到最前面,然后再由自动抬板机抬板,放在托盘上码垛,方便叉车运输,省掉抬板工人,减轻劳动强度,实现自动化码垛。本新型具有自动化程度,产品质量好等诸多优点。
现有技术的五辊压延覆合生产装置配有很多种类型的花辊,并且更换的频率非常的高,本申请中提供的五辊压延覆合生产装置将平台装在墙板的两侧,前后为分体,中间以留出拆卸花辊的位置,用花纹板折弯后盖在前后平台上,用螺栓连接。拆卸花辊先把升降机的螺栓松开,在用行车吊装花辊的轴头端,连轴承座一起拆卸。提高了安装和更换花辊的便利性,提高了生产效率并降低了维护成本。
